The mantra here is SAMPLING bro...
U have to keep on sampling...sampling and sampling...
Don't reluctant to buy sample,vial or decant.

In my case,i've spent a lot on samples even for the designer perfume ones...
First impression not really the best evaluation to decide u will like it or not...
The second mantra is RE-VISIT. Happened many times to me.
U have to re-visit the sample that u don't like after quite some time.After that u will surprise some of them,u will like it after all.

Didn’t get to try Van Cleef but I went and re-test the Reserve Collection

A bit disappointed with Arabian Wood. Opens with bright woodsy notes before dialing down into soapy floral. My skin reveals more of its vetiver notes which makes it smell like an expensive soap. Sad that it smells nicer on paper than on my skin.

Wanted to get Venetian Bergamot but it’s out of stock.

laugh.gif left my number to reserve a bottle

As for MFK , I prefer the silver GF, tho I’ll have to agree that it smells like a mashup of the two you mentioned.
